Certain Songs #902: Led Zeppelin – “When The Levee Breaks”

June 9, 2017 by Jim Connelly

Album:
Year: 1971

“If it keeps on raining,” she said, “The levee’s gonna break.”

In their all-time greatest recording (if not my favorite of their songs) (though sometimes it is), Led Zeppelin turn the blues upside down using the simple trick of recording John Bonham from the other side of the universe, and then taking advantage of the light-years it took for his playing to actually get to the studio by filling in as much of the space and time with guitars, harmonica and Robert Plant trying to sound like both a guitar and harmonica.

Certain Songs #901: Led Zeppelin – “Four Sticks”

June 8, 2017 by Jim Connelly

Album:
Year: 1971

The fourth Led Zeppelin album isn’t quite my favorite Led Zeppelin album, but pound-for-pound it’s probably their best. Which is why it was so hard to figure out which songs to write about: pretty much everything here is as great as Zeppelin — and therefore rock and roll — ever got.

So the only song that I was going to for sure write about was “When The Levee Breaks” (tomorrow!) and the only I was for sure going to skip was “Going To California” (I already live here), but as for the others go, it could have been any combination of the other six songs. So just because I didn’t get to “Black Dog,” “Battle of Evermore” or “Misty Mountain Hop” doesn’t mean that they weren’t under heavy consideration. Because that’s just how ridiculous this record is.

Certain Songs #900: Led Zeppelin – “Stairway to Heaven”

June 7, 2017 by Jim Connelly

Album:
Year: 1971

The “Smells Like Teen Spirit” of the Baby Boomers, “Stairway to Heaven” has, of course, become much much larger than a mere rock and roll song, but rather a key symbol of the era when rock ‘n’ roll became rock, as well as arguably the most important thing not just in popular culture, but the culture at large.

Of course, that’s just the young teenage boy in me speaking, and I’m pretty sure that I remember people talking about “Stairway to Heaven” before I experienced it firsthand. In fact, I’d like to report I remember the first time I heard “Stairway to Heaven,” that it was some kind of lightning bolt or something, but no. I’m sure that I caught it somewhere in the middle, during some tuning of the radio dial looking for new sounds, or maybe Craig from across the street played it for me.

Certain Songs #899: Led Zeppelin – “Rock and Roll”

June 6, 2017 by Jim Connelly

Album:
Year: 1971

Man, that drum intro! Right?

Using nothing but his kick, snare and a wide-open hi-hat, John Bonham spontaneously created an intro that will be imitated by drummers for just about ever. The legend has it that they were trying (and failing) to tame the rather tricky “Four Sticks,” and Bonzo just came up with what became the intro to their simplest and most straightforward rock and roll song.
